CTIA Calls Neustar Allegations 'Misconceived'

CTIA called “misconceived” Neustar’s claims that Ericsson’s connections to the association influenced its support for Ericsson subsidiary Telcordia's selection as the next local number portability administrator, said an ex parte filing. Neustar wrote the FCC Tuesday in another ex parte…

filing, saying Ericsson President Angel Ruiz is secretary of CTIA’s board. "CTIA’s advocacy reflects the point of view of the largest wireless carriers who have strategic or commercial reasons” for Telcordia’s selection, Neustar wrote. CTIA responded that it’s “no secret that CTIA is a trade association that represents its members’ interests -- including twenty-six carriers that serve more than 96 percent of the nation’s wireless customers. ... Neustar evidently does not think its own advocacy should be discounted simply because of its obvious personal stake in this proceeding.”
